One of the advantages of using recipe kits is the ability to customize the pad thai easy homemade version to suit personal preferences. For example, if you prefer a spicier kick, you can add chili flakes or Sriracha after cooking. If you're vegetarian, you can substitute the fish sauce with soy sauce or tamari and omit the shrimp.
